The TES standard data products are for global survey observations only, conducted in a one-day-on / one-day-off mode. During the "off" days, special observations can be scheduled. The following tables list the TES standard products.

Level 1B Products
TES Level 1B data contain radiometric calibrated spectral radiances and their corresponding noise equivalent spectral radiances (NESR). The geolocation, quality and some engineering data are also provided. Each L1B data file contains data from a single TES orbit starting from the South Pole Apex.
A separate product file is produced for each different atmospheric species. Each of these files is referred to an Earth Science Data Type (ESDT). The following table consists of the eight unique nadir and limb files based on the focal plane for an orbit.

The filename for a L1B standard product is constructed using the following template:
TES-Aura_L1B-view_FPFP_r<run id>-o<orbit number>_<version id>.h5
- view determines whether the file uses the Nadir or Limb view
- FP represents the focal plane (1A,1B,2A,2B)
- run id represents the ten-digit run identification number
- orbit number represents the starting five-digit Absolute Orbit number, which is the same as the Aura orbit number at the time of the South Pole apex crossing
- version id represents the version identification number, which is used to keep track of file format changes.
- .h5 extension denotes the use of HDF 5 format.

Level 2 Products [Return to top]
In general, TES Level 2 data contain retrieved species (or temperature) profiles at the observation targets and the estimated errors. The geolocation, quality and some other data (e.g., surface characteristics for nadir observations) are also provided. The following table lists TES Level 2 standard products.

L2 modeled spectra are evaluated using radiative transfer modeling algorithms. The process, referred to as retrieval, compares observed spectra to the modeled spectra and iteratively updates the atmospheric parameters.
L2 standard product files include information for one molecular species (or temperature) for an entire global survey or special observation run. A global survey consists of a maximum of 16 consecutive orbits. Nadir and limb observations are in separate L2 files, and a single ancillary file is composed of data that are common to both nadir and limb files.

The filename for a L2 standard product is constructed using the following template:
TES-Aura_L2-species-view_rrun id_version id.he5
- species refers to which molecule or temperature the file uses
- view determines whether the file uses the Nadir or Limb view
- run id represents the ten-digit run identification number
- version id represents the version identification number, which is used to keep track of file format changes
- .he5 extension denotes the use of HDF EOS 5 format

Level 3 Products [Return to top]
The objective of the TES Science Data Processing L3 subsystem is to interpolate the L2 atmospheric profiles collected in a Global Survey onto a global grid uniform in latitude and longitude that will provide a 3-D representation of the distribution of atmospheric gasses. Daily and monthly averages of L2 profiles and browse images will also be provided.
The L3 standard data products are composed of L3 HDF-EOS grid data.
A separate product file is produced for each different atmospheric species. Each of these files is referred to an Earth Science Data Type (ESDT). TES obtains data in two basic observation modes: Limb or Nadir. The product file may contain, in separate folders, limb data, nadir data, or both folders may be present.
Specific to L3 processing are the terms "Daily" and "Monthly" representing the approximate time coverage of the L3 products. However the input data granules to the L3 process will be complete Global Surveys; in other words a Global Survey will not be split in relation to time when input to the L3 processes even if they exceed the usual understood meanings of a day or month.
More specifically:
- Daily L3 products represent a single Global Survey (approximately 26 hours)
- Monthly L3 products represent Global Surveys that are initiated within that calendar month.
The data granules defined for L3 standard products are "daily" and "monthly". L3 data is provided at uniform grids in latitude and longitude and at selected pressure levels.
